TX5RV – Raivavae – Austral Islands

Don, VE7DS and Dave, K3EL undertook a mini-dxpedition to Raivavae, (FO/A, Austral Islands, IOTA OC-114) from 30 October to 6 November 2013. The Austral Islands were at that time 44th on the Club Log “most wanted” list, very high for a fly-in destination, with a particularly low percentage of Club Log users having contacts on 10 or 12 m. Callsign was be TX5RV.

This was not intended to be a full-on dxpedition (we were travelling with our XYLs, hence spent some time away from the radios), but there was significant on-the-air time for approximately one week, running two medium-power stations with vertical antennas on the beach.
